Is there another option besides disability?

I am 24 years old and suffer from Bipolar Disorder. I am unable to hold a job because of my severe "outbreaks" of anger or anxiety. The longest I have held a job is maybe no longer than 6 months. I have not been able to be on medication for my disorder since I was 18 because my Medicaid insurance expired. I live in a small country town in Alabama that refuses medical treatment of any kind if you do not have medical insurance. I have tried the local Health Department and they have not been helpful either. Many people have suggested I apply for disability for medical insurance benefits. But, is this the only option I have available? I am currently unemployed and cannot find employment since Jan. of '09. I have no available funds to pay for programs like nationwide insurance or others. If this is not my only option can someone please help me so that I may seek the medical help I need? My psychotic episodes have seriously strained my life and relationships and I am very unhappy. Any help would be appreciated.
